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these problems can assist you know when to require professional a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working entirely, particularly during severe weather condition, it's more than just an inconvenience-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C specialists can diagnose and repair the issue quickly,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ically signal a serious mechanical issue that might result in bigger concerns if not addressed quickly. Likewise, uncommon smells may indicate electrical issues or even gas leaks. Our professional HVAC contractors can determine these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old growth. Our professionals locate the source of leakages and fix them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ages reduce your a/c unit's cooling capacity and can damage the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ical components in your HVAC system position fire risks and need to be dealt with instantly by qualified professionals. Our HVAC professionals have the training to safely repair electrical issues.

Air Conditioning Maintenance

Regular maintenance keeps your cooling system running efficiently. Our expert HVAC contractors carry out comprehensive maintenance services that consist of:

  • Cleaning or replacing air filters
  • Examining refrigerant levels
  •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
  • Checking and cleaning drain lines
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Lubricating moving parts
  • Testing thermostat operation
  • Verifying proper air flow

Heater Maintenance

Regular maintenance prevents numerous he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C contractors perform thorough maintenance services that include: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Checking combustion effectiveness
  • Evaluating safety controls
  • Cleaning or changing filters
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Lubricating moving parts
  • Cleaning up bur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and lowers comfort. Our HVAC professionals determine air flow issues, whether brought on by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ation problems,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can detect these problems and advise options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ears components quicker. Our HVAC professionals can determine whether the problem stems from a blocked fil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ected increases in energy costs frequently ind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als perform energy performance evaluations to identify the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can recommend services to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what looks like a system failure is in fact a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or smart models for much better convenience control and energy savings.

Getting Ready For H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when needed.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the location of your HVAC devices and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Regular expert upkeep minimizes the probability of emergencies. Our HVAC contractors can establish a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ide gas detectors supply an early warning of dangerous leakages.
